Newly promoted Hapoel Ramat Gan/Givatayim continued its preparations for the 2026/27 season on Tuesday by announcing two new signings after earning promotion to the Premier League. The club brought in 22-year-old striker Idan Baranes on loan from Hapoel Tel Aviv through the end of the season.
Baranes joined Hapoel Tel Aviv after being bought from Maccabi Netanya, and he spent last season on loan at Ironi Tiberias. Hapoel also signed 22-year-old winger Amit Tzur, who came through Maccabi Tel Aviv and was once part of Israel’s youth national team. Tzur played for Hapoel Rishon LeZion last season and signed for one year with an option for another.
Baranes said he arrives determined to help the club deliver a season that will make the fans proud. He added that he was impressed by the club’s rebuild and is waiting for his first training session, saying he looks forward to hearing the red crowd chant his name. Tzur said he is excited to join what he called a new project, praised the club’s support last season, and said he is coming in more hungry than ever to produce success and achievements.
